Another popular application of microwaves is for radar, a technology that is used by airplanes, ships, and air traffic controllers. RADAR works by sending a short burst of microwaves. In return, the echoes are detected and used to calculate the distance between the source and the target.
There are a variety of technologies that use microwaves, including radar guns, motion detectors, cell phones, and radar altimeters. These devices can be solid-state or vacuum-tube based.
